Jean-Michel Basquiat (1960-1988) is considered on of the most important artists of the 20th century.

His career spanned the late 1970s through the 1980s until his death in 1988.

His paintings are typically covered with text and codes of all kinds: words, letters, numerals, pictograms, logos, map symbols, diagrams and more.
